首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

循环遍历最后5个datalist项,获取值& html

循环遍历最后5个datalist项,获取值的方法可以使用JavaScript编程语言中的循环结构来实现。以下是一个示例代码:

代码语言:txt
复制
var datalist = [1, 2, 3, 4, 5, 6, 7, 8, 9, 10];
var lastFiveItems = datalist.slice(-5); // 获取最后5个项

for (var i = 0; i < lastFiveItems.length; i++) {
  var value = lastFiveItems[i];
  console.log("值:" + value);
}

在上述代码中,我们首先定义了一个包含10个元素的datalist数组。然后,使用slice()方法从数组的末尾截取了最后5个项,存储在lastFiveItems变量中。接下来,使用for循环遍历lastFiveItems数组,并将每个项的值打印到控制台。

关于HTML部分,如果你想将获取到的值展示在网页上,可以使用以下代码:

代码语言:txt
复制
<!DOCTYPE html>
<html>
<head>
  <title>循环遍历最后5个datalist项</title>
</head>
<body>
  <ul id="datalist"></ul>

  <script>
    var datalist = [1, 2, 3, 4, 5, 6, 7, 8, 9, 10];
    var lastFiveItems = datalist.slice(-5); // 获取最后5个项

    var datalistElement = document.getElementById("datalist");

    for (var i = 0; i < lastFiveItems.length; i++) {
      var value = lastFiveItems[i];
      var listItem = document.createElement("li");
      listItem.textContent = "值:" + value;
      datalistElement.appendChild(listItem);
    }
  </script>
</body>
</html>

在上述HTML代码中,我们首先创建了一个无序列表(<ul>)元素,并为其指定了一个id属性为"datalist"。然后,使用JavaScript代码获取到这个列表元素,并将遍历得到的值创建为列表项(<li>)元素,并添加到列表中。

这样,你就可以在网页上看到最后5个datalist项的值以列表的形式展示出来了。

对于这个问题,腾讯云并没有特定的产品与之相关。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Python网页爬取_在pycharm里面如何爬取网页

,解析网页数据,匹对正则表达式 可以看出爬取的数据由 标签包裹,所以只需遍历循环此标签即可。...(html,"html.parser") #t_list=bs.find_all("div",class_="hot-img") #因为class是一个类别,所以需要加一个下划线,不然会报错<div class...print(authorlist) contentlist = re.findall(content,item)[0][1] #contentlist里我们只需要第二个数据,将他看作为二维数组,后面对应取值即可...(data) #print(datalist) return datalist 六、将得到的数据保存在excel中 def saveData(dataList): Book=xlwt.Workbook(...)):#第一次循环应是将行数,有多少数据有多少行 data=dataList[i] #每一条数据应该放在一行里,所以将在一次进行for循环 for j in range(len(line)): sheet.write

1.9K20

C++ Qt开发:TableView与TreeView组件联动

以下是 QItemSelectionModel 的一些重要特性和方法:选择: 负责管理模型中的的选择状态,可以单独选择、选定范围内的或清除所有选择。...继续创建一个包含三个字符串列表的数组 DataList,每个列表代表一行数据。然后使用嵌套的循环遍历数组,将数据逐个添加到模型中。...<< "lyshark" << "23" << "男" << "否";DataList[2] << "1003" << "lucy" << "37" << "女" << "是";通过循环添加数据到模型使用两个循环...,外层循环遍历数组,内层循环遍历每个数组中的元素,创建 QStandardItem 对象并将其添加到模型的相应位置。...Item); }}如上这段代码初始化了一个包含表头和数据的 QStandardItemModel 模型,然后将模型和选择模型关联到 tableView 和 treeView 上,最后通过循环将数据逐个添加到模型中

36910
  • 面试题分享,修改数据无法更新UI

    开始一个例子 新建一个index.html ......: ['Maic', 'Test']},首先会遍历dataList,获取dataList的值,然后把数组的值进行observe,在observe中,我们可以看到,如果这个值不是对象,直接通过isObject..._data[key] = val } }) } } 由于dataList在初始化的时候,数组中每一都会先进行循环,如果是对象,则会遍历数组内部的对象,然后添加响应式...,每一都会dep依赖 但是由于dataList的每一是数组字符串,我们可以继续看到这段代码 var Observer = function Observer(value) { // debugger...所以你修改this.dataList[0] = "111";,因为dataList的每一item并不是一个对象,并没有被observer,所以修改其值,只是改变对原对象值,但是根本不会触​发拦截对象的

    1.3K20

    HTML5标签2

    input 控件(重点) 在上面的语法中,标签为单标签,type属性为其最基本的属性,其取值有多种,用于指定不同的控件类型。...在option 中定义selected =" selected "时,当前项即为默认选中。...method 用于设置表单数据的提交方式,其取值为get或post。 name 用于指定表单的名称,以区分同一个页面中的多个表单。 注意: 每个表单都应该有自己表单域。...并且可以通过附加属性可以更友好控制音频的播放,如: autoplay 自动播放 controls 是否显不默认播放控件 loop 循环播放 loop = 2 就是循环2次 loop 或者 loop =..."-1" 无限循环 由于版权等原因,不同的浏览器可支持播放的格式是不一样的  多浏览器支持的方案,如下图 ?

    2.5K40

    Redis 中 scan 命令踩坑,千万别乱用!!

    scan命令会返回一个数组,第一为游标的位置,第二是key的列表。如果游标到达了末尾,第一会返回0。...原来count选项后面跟的数字并不是意味着每次返回的元素数量,而是scan命令每次遍历字典槽的数量 我scan执行的时候每一次都是从游标0的位置开始遍历,而并不是每一个字典槽里都存放着我所需要筛选的数据...,这就造成了我最后的一个现象:虽然我count后面跟的是10000,但是实际redis从开头往下遍历了10000个字典槽后,发现没有数据槽存放着我所需要的数据。...所以我最后的dbsize数量永远停留在了124204个。...最后也得到了游标返回0,也就是到了末尾。至此,测试数据20w被全部删完。 这段lua只要在套上shell进行循环就可以直接在生产上跑了。经过估算大概在12分钟左右能删除掉500w的数据。

    7.9K60

    「数据结构与算法Javascript描述」十大排序算法

    然后,内循环将从第一位迭代至倒数第二位,内循环实际上进行当前项和下一的比较。如果这两顺序不对(当前项比下一大),则交换它们,意思是位置为j+1的值将会被换置到位置j处,反之亦然。...选择排序会用到嵌套循环。外循环从数组的第一个元素移动到倒数第二个元素;内循环从第二个数组元素移动到最后一个元素,查找比当前外循环所指向的元素小的元素。...接下来,将left数组或者right数组所有剩余的添加到归并数组中。最后,将归并数组作为结果返回。...首先,从数组中选择中间一作为「主元」。 创建两个指针,左边一个指向数组第一个,右边一个指向数组最后一个。...当开始用这个算法遍历数据集时,所有元素之间的距离会不断减小,直到处理到数据集的末尾,这时算法比较的就是相邻元素了。

    96320

    【Python爬虫】 电影Top250信息

    2.2.2 得到制定一个URL的网页内容 2.2.3 调用10次25份数据,解析网页 2.3解析内容 2.4保存数据 3.补充 3.1 urllib 3.2 BeautifulSoup 3.2.1 文档的遍历...(url) #获取一页html,保存获取到的网页源码 #逐一解析数据【注意:是在for循环里面解析,弄到一个网页解析一下】 return datalist 2.3解析内容 解析影片详情链接为例...#2.逐一解析数据【注意:是在for循环里面解析,弄到一个网页解析一下】 soup=BeautifulSoup(html,"html.parser") for item...是在for循环里面解析,弄到一个网页解析一下】 soup=BeautifulSoup(html,"html.parser") for item in soup.find_all...utf-8") # print(html) return html #保存数据 def saveData(datalist,savepath): book = xlwt.Workbook

    47420

    接口测试平台代码实现96:全局域名-3

    怎么显示呢,这里我们要在html页面中设计一个列表存放所有的host,并让host输入框绑定这个列表。 其实说是列表,实际上是一个datalist的下拉列表。...这个下拉列表中,使用了一个for循环遍历我们应该接收的hosts,hosts是我们后端应该给前端传递的所有host列表(不过我们现在还没有传) 然后在host输入框中加入了这个list="" 属性,即可绑定成功...注意上面的datalist的id 和 input中这个list=""的内容 要一致,这里都写成了datalist_1 然后我们去后端,找到进入接口库的设置数据的函数child_json: 如上图,添加了这个...最后,让我们把这段前端代码复制到 用例库中输入host的位置。 打开P_cases.html,找到这个位置。插入红色框代码和 增加input框的俩个属性。...接下来是首页的快捷调试功能: 打开home.html: 然后是views.py: 重启服务,刷新页面: 成功设置好。 现在我们的智能联想功能就算做好了。

    83340

    【Shell】算术运算符、流程控制、函数使用、数组以及加载其它文件的变量

    1.8 函数使用 1 函数的快速入门 2 传递参数给函数 1.9 数组 1 定义数组 2 读取数组 3 遍历数组 1.10 加载其它文件的变量 1 简介 2 练习 1.6 Shell算术运算符 1...取值后面必须为单词 in ,每一模式必须以右括号结束。取值可以为变量或常 数。匹配发现取值符合某一模式后,其间所有命令开始执行直至 ;; 。 取值将检测匹配的每一个模式。...参数返回,可以显示加: return 返回,如果不加,将以最后一条命令运行结果,作为返回 值。...在函数体内部,通过 的 形 式 来 取 参 数 的 值 , 例 如 , 1 表示 第一个参数, $2 表示第二个参数 ......带参数的函数示例: 输出结果: 注意, 不 能 取 第 十 个 参 数 , 取 第 十 个 参 数 需 要 {10} 。

    3.1K30

    (四)Lua脚本语言入门

    >  这项功能之前, 直接List DataList = new List();//链表 假设我做的程序就是存取string类型的,那么我自己知道是存入string类型的,所以自己会存string类型,...事先规定存入的数据类型",一功能 java中遍历数组 ? 今天连怎么建工程都忘了............ 对于C#的遍历 ?...可以说Lua设计的遍历更便捷,,既可以返回数据也可以返回下标 有时候会想对于C#的遍历数组 ?...这个函数的功能就是能返回数组的下标和下标对应的值然后通过泛型for,有一功能,按照某种格式(像上面的格式) pairs(a)返回的下标就传给了i,下标对应的值就传给了j ?...在for执行过程中 io.lines 这个迭代器一直把数据传给 line 然后判断 line是不是为nil如果是就结束循环,如果不是就执行 io.write(line,"\n"),,,,, 没数据了io.lines

    1.8K50

    Django 基础快速入门

    us.html 文件,并且给定对应的 html 内容如下: 最后我们再到 Django 下的 urls.py 文件下配置好一个路由,使其使用 us 方法做处理: 接着我们刷新服务或关闭服务后启动...roles 值的第一个元素,刷新页面即可看到如下显示内容: 6.2 遍历取值 若当数组过多,取值并不方便且需要显示时,可以通过前端模板的循环语法取值。...span>{{item}} {% endfor %} 以上代码使用 for 对 roles 进行遍历,其每一遍历时用 item 作为指向,随后循环体为 {{...for 循环取值 在对字典取值时还可以使用 for 循环取值(键名)。...此时我们对 vallist 这个数据在前端进行遍历,随后进行判断: 首先我们需要一个循环遍历 valList 这个字典数据: {% for item in valList %} {% endfor

    1.7K20

    ViewPager 实现 Galler 效果, 中间大图显示,两边小图展示

    正常情况下, ViewPager 一页只能显示一数据, 但是我们常常看到网上,特别是电视机顶盒的首页经常出现中间大图显示两端也都露出一点来,这种效果怎么实现呢?...2,实现无限循环很简单,网上也有很多的解决方案,我这里不考虑性能上的东西,且看下面简单的代码: private class ImageAdapter extends PagerAdapter{...Object instantiateItem(ViewGroup container, int position) { //对ViewPager页号求模取出View列表中要显示的...instantiateItem() 方法position的处理:由于我们设置了count为 Integer.MAX_VALUE,因此这个position的取值范围很大很大,但我们实际要显示的内容肯定没这么多...MIN_SCALE) / (1 - MIN_SCALE) * (1 - MIN_ALPHA)); } } } <pre name="code" class="<em>html</em>

    3.8K50
    领券